Suppliers Bargaining Power

Icon

Specialized component dependence

Ralliant depends on precision components, advanced materials, and certified electronic parts that are hard to source in volume. In defense and space work, many inputs must pass strict qualification tests, which cuts the supplier pool and lifts supplier leverage on price, lead times, and allocation. When demand tightens, these niche vendors can pass through cost pressure fast.

Icon

Long qualification cycles

Ralliant Corp. faces high supplier power because critical instruments and subsystems often need long testing, audits, and customer sign-off before approval. Once a part is qualified, switching can mean redesign and revalidation, which can delay programs and raise costs. That lock-in gives suppliers more pricing power, especially in high-spec 2025 production chains.

Defense-grade sourcing risk

Defense and space sourcing is tighter than commercial sourcing because every part must meet traceability, reliability, and export-control rules like ITAR and AS9100. That leaves a smaller, more concentrated pool of qualified suppliers, so their bargaining power is higher. For Ralliant Corp., that can mean less pricing leverage and longer lead times when a critical vendor is hard to replace.

Limited dual sourcing

Ralliant Corp. faces higher supplier power when specialty sensors and subsystem inputs come from only one or two credible sources. That limits price pressure on suppliers, and Ralliant’s main fixes—inventory buffers and supplier development—need time and cash, so the near-term leverage stays with vendors.

Where dual sourcing is hard to set up, suppliers can ask for better terms, tighter lead times, and less flexibility on quality or design changes. In practice, the risk is highest in narrow, technical parts chains where qualification takes months, not weeks.

  • One or two-source inputs lift supplier leverage
  • Inventory helps, but it ties up cash
  • Supplier development takes time to scale
  • Limited dual sourcing supports better vendor terms

Mitigation through scale and design

Ralliant Corp. can cut supplier power by redesigning products, standardizing parts, and buying from a larger platform, which raises volume leverage and lowers part-specific dependence. Vertical coordination and long-term contracts can smooth lead times and pricing. Still, precision parts and mission-critical quality keep supplier power moderately high.

  • Standard parts lower switching risk.
  • Scale strengthens price talks.
  • Contracts help stabilize supply.
  • Quality needs keep suppliers powerful.

Customers Bargaining Power

Icon

Large account concentration

Ralliant Corp. faces strong buyer power because its customer base likely includes defense primes, aerospace firms, and industrial OEMs that buy in large lots and push hard on price, service, and delivery. When a few large accounts drive demand, those buyers can press for lower margins and tighter terms. Concentrated demand makes switching costly for Ralliant Corp., but it also gives customers more leverage in procurement.

Icon

High switching scrutiny

Customers in test, measurement, and defense systems compare performance, reliability, and total lifecycle cost before they switch, so replacement decisions can take months or years. Even when renewal comes up, they use benchmark data and vendor quotes to push for lower prices and better service terms. That keeps Ralliant Corp. facing meaningful buyer power, especially on large multi-year contracts.

Mission critical requirements

Ralliant’s products sit in mission-critical jobs, so buyers care more about qualification, uptime, and accuracy than list price. In Fortive’s latest disclosed segment data before the spin, the business was tied to about $2.4 billion of annual revenue, showing a large installed base that depends on reliable performance. Still, customers can push for compliance, warranties, and service terms when failure can stop production or testing.

Procurement discipline

Government and prime-contractor buyers keep strong leverage over Ralliant Corp. Their procurement teams use competitive bids, framework deals, and supplier scorecards to squeeze price and terms. In U.S. federal contracting, obligations were about $750B in FY2024, so even small margin cuts on large programs matter.

  • Cost focus keeps pricing pressure high
  • Bids and scorecards punish weak suppliers
  • Long contracts can still reset margins

Service and integration lock in

Ralliant Corp. can keep customer power moderate by tying its systems into customer workflows, software, and test platforms, so buyers face real friction when they try to switch. Calibration, installation, and aftersales support add time and cost, and that lock-in gets stronger as equipment sits deeper in daily use. In 2025, this kind of service-heavy model matters more than price alone because switching disrupts uptime and qualification work.

  • Embedded systems raise switching costs.
  • Support and calibration deepen lock-in.
  • Customer power stays moderate, not extreme.

Rivalry Among Competitors

Icon

Established precision competitors

Ralliant faces fierce rivalry from established precision names in test and measurement, sensing, and engineered systems, where brands like Keysight, Teledyne, and AMETEK bring deep technical expertise and global sales reach. That scale matters: performance-led contracts often go to the vendor with the strongest specs, fastest support, and broadest installed base. In 2025, the category stayed highly competitive because these peers still operate at multi-billion-dollar revenue scale.

Icon

Pressure on innovation

Customers keep pushing Ralliant Corp. to improve accuracy, miniaturization, and connectivity, so rivals must launch newer platforms and add software, analytics, and automation. That raises R&D pressure and makes the fight more aggressive, because product cycles get shorter and feature gaps close fast. In 2025, the market reward went to firms that proved clear upgrade speed, not just hardware quality.

Fragmented segment mix

Ralliant Corp. sells into multiple end markets, but each niche has specialist rivals, so rivalry stays high. In fragmented lines, suppliers fight for a small set of program wins, which pushes price cuts and faster feature upgrades. That pressure is real across the portfolio, especially where customers can switch after one bid cycle.

Defense and space bidding

Defense and space bidding is highly rivalrous because a few huge awards can decide years of revenue; in FY2025, U.S. defense spending stayed near the $850B range, so primes fought hard for each design win. Companies also spend heavily before any production starts, which raises sunk costs and makes them push even harder for long-run work. That winner-take-most setup keeps pricing and capture teams under constant pressure.

  • Few awards, big revenue swings
  • High upfront bid and design costs
  • Long contracts intensify rivalry

Brand and qualification moats

Brand and qualification moats do soften direct price wars in Ralliant Corp.'s markets, because customers often stick with suppliers that are already approved and proven. But rivalry still stays high: competitors can win on faster timing, custom specs, or lower lifecycle cost, so differentiation matters more than price alone.

  • Approved suppliers cut price pressure.
  • Rivals still compete on speed and fit.
  • Lifecycle cost can beat a strong brand.
  • Differentiated products help Ralliant defend share.

Substitutes Threaten

Icon

Alternative measurement platforms

Alternative measurement platforms are a real substitute for Ralliant Corp. when customers can swap a dedicated instrument for a multifunction or software-defined system. That can cut demand for standalone test hardware in mixed-use labs, and as digital tools get better, consolidation into one platform can replace 2 to 5 boxes in some setups. The pressure is strongest where uptime, remote control, and lower capex matter most.

Icon

In house engineering solutions

Large aerospace and defense customers can build sensing or test systems in-house, especially on low-volume programs where they want tighter data control and cleaner system integration. That makes internal development a real substitute for some contracts, not just a backup option. The threat is reinforced by FY2025 U.S. defense spending of $849.8 billion, which keeps engineering teams and lab budgets active inside major primes and government programs.

Lower cost standard products

For less demanding uses, buyers can switch to commodity sensors or generic lab gear, which are cheaper than Ralliant Corp.'s precision products. Those substitutes may lose accuracy, but they still fit budget-limited commercial buyers, so price pressure stays real. This makes substitution risk highest in price-sensitive segments, where even small performance gaps do not justify the premium.

Software and virtual testing

Software and virtual testing raise the threat of substitutes for Ralliant Corp. because simulation, digital twins, and remote diagnostics let customers validate designs before they buy or use hardware in final tests. Digital-twin spending is already scaling fast, with market estimates near $20 billion in 2024 and forecast growth above 30% a year, which shows how quickly virtual workflows are taking share from some physical test steps.

This does not replace all Ralliant Corp. products, but it can narrow demand for standalone equipment in early design and qualification work. The pressure is strongest where customers want faster iteration, lower lab cost, and fewer prototype builds, so hardware use shifts toward final verification, field service, and edge cases that software cannot fully cover.

  • Virtual tools cut early-stage hardware use.
  • Digital twins speed design validation.
  • Remote diagnostics reduce test visits.
  • Final-stage physical testing still matters.

Performance critical differentiation

Ralliant Corp. is protected most by performance critical use cases, where customers pay for high accuracy, traceability, and uptime. In those jobs, substitutes often miss the reliability and compliance bar, so they are not close replacements.

The threat of substitutes is moderate overall, but low in the hardest applications where failure can halt production or risk safety. One clean rule: when precision is audited, price alone does not win.

  • High accuracy cuts substitution risk.
  • Compliance limits low-cost replacements.
  • Best defense: mission critical performance.

Entrants Threaten

Icon

High capital and capability needs

High capital and capability needs make entry into precision instruments and engineered defense systems hard. New firms must fund specialized equipment, engineering teams, and quality systems upfront, often spending millions before landing a first contract. In defense, customer approval and qualification can take 12 to 24 months, so trust and scale stay with established players like Ralliant Corp.

Icon

Certification barriers

Defense, aerospace, and regulated industrial buyers demand long test cycles, full traceability, and formal approvals, so newcomers face slow and costly entry. Global military spending reached $2.72 trillion in 2024, and much of that market still depends on certified suppliers, not fast movers. For Ralliant Corp., AS9100, ITAR, and similar approvals raise the bar and lower the threat of new entrants.

Customer trust and incumbency

Buyers in mission-critical equipment favor vendors with long field records, and validation cycles can run 12-24 months, so new entrants face a slow path to trust. Ralliant Corp. has the edge from installed-base credibility, repeat relationships, and a reliability reputation built over many operating cycles. That makes displacement hard, even when a newcomer offers a lower price.

IP and design complexity

IP and design complexity raises entry barriers for Ralliant Corp because many products depend on proprietary designs, process know-how, and micron-level tolerances. New entrants must match both performance and yield, so copying the product is not enough; they must also prove stable production at scale.

This makes entry slow and costly, especially where failure rates or drift can hurt margins. In practice, the moat is not one patent but the full stack of design, process control, and quality systems.

  • Proprietary IP blocks easy copying
  • Process know-how drives yield
  • Tight tolerances lift startup cost

Niche startup pressure

Small startups can still break into narrow sensor or software-adjacent niches with fast prototypes and early pilot wins, especially in less regulated commercial markets. But scaling into defense and space is much harder because qualification, security, and long buying cycles raise barriers. So the entrant threat for Ralliant Corp. stays low to moderate.

  • Fast pilots: possible in niche commercial segments.
  • Scale hurdle: defense and space are tougher.
  • Net effect: low-to-moderate threat.
